Top recipes for meals made with freeze-dried ingredients?

April 5, 2026

Quick Answer

Freeze-dried ingredients can be used to prepare a wide variety of meals, including hearty stews, flavorful stir-fries, and satisfying breakfast dishes. When combined with dehydrated meats, spices, and other ingredients, freeze-dried meals can be both nutritious and convenient. These dishes are perfect for camping, backpacking, or emergency preparedness.

Building a Freeze-Dried Meal

Freeze-dried ingredients can be rehydrated with hot water, making them ideal for soups, stews, and other liquid-based meals. For example, a combination of freeze-dried beef, potatoes, carrots, and onions can be rehydrated to create a hearty beef stew. To prepare, simply add 2 cups of hot water to 1 cup of freeze-dried ingredients and let it sit for 10-15 minutes.

Adding Flavor and Texture

Freeze-dried meals can be elevated by adding dehydrated spices, herbs, and other ingredients. For a flavorful stir-fry, combine freeze-dried vegetables, such as broccoli and bell peppers, with soy sauce and garlic powder. To add texture, sprinkle some dehydrated nuts or seeds on top of the dish. This will not only add crunch but also provide a boost of protein and healthy fats.

Preparing Freeze-Dried Meals at Home

If you have a freeze-dryer at home, you can create your own freeze-dried meals by dehydrating ingredients such as fruits, vegetables, meats, and herbs. For example, you can freeze-dry strawberries to create a sweet and healthy snack or freeze-dry chicken breast to create a protein-rich meal. Simply slice the ingredients thinly, place them on the freeze-dryer trays, and set the machine to the recommended temperature and time.
